Abstract
Large Language Models (LLMs) are widely used for code generation, yet their security behavior in realistic development workflows remains underexplored. Existing benchmarks often rely on explicitly specified security requirements, failing to capture real-world scenarios where prompts are frequently ambiguous or incomplete.
